Hi guys, i ordered G35 Sedan JWT intakes for my car, waited for 2 weeks (since i live outside the US) for them to arrived, i opened the box and i was shocked that they are 2007+ 350z JWT intakes, they costed me $510 shipped to my country, and if i want to ship them back for replaced i'll pay another $250 for them shipped to and back from the US.
I want to know if they fit or if they don't, and why?

Thank god, i got a confirmation from JWT that the only difference is the tiny upper heat shield brackets, you can make those at home, but i'm getting the right bracket shipped directly to my country, in the mean while i'll just install the intakes without them
